Staining a Fiberglass Door
Staining a fiberglass door is an artistic yet technically exacting home improvement project that replicates the timeless beauty of natural oak, mahogany, or cherry on a durable synthetic entry door. While unpainted fiberglass doors arrive from the manufacturer with an embossed, wood-grained textured surface, achieving an authentic multi-tonal wood appearance requires understanding color theory, glaze manipulation, and proper curing chemistry. Executed correctly, a stained fiberglass door resists warping, rotting, and insect infestation while welcoming guests with rich architectural elegance.
Anatomy of Textured Fiberglass and Multi-Tone Color Theory
Textured fiberglass entry doors are manufactured using compression-molded sheet molding compound (SMC) pressed into cast nickel dies cast directly from real wood timber planks. This molding process creates microscopic peaks and valleys that perfectly replicate open pores, heartwood grain rings, and natural timber medullary rays. However, unlike natural timber where natural variations in lignum density create subtle color shifts, synthetic fiberglass is completely uniform in base tone.
Achieving authentic visual depth on fiberglass requires employing a multi-tone color layering technique. Rather than applying a single heavy coat of dark stain—which can look muddy and flat—professional finishers often apply a lighter base tone (such as natural honey or golden oak gel stain) as the foundational wash. Once dry, a darker accent gel stain (such as dark walnut or espresso) is applied sparingly and feathered across the grain crevices to create realistic high-contrast grain highlights that mirror aged hardwood.
The table below details popular wood-tone color recipes and layering combinations for staining fiberglass doors.
| Target Wood Appearance | Base Gel Stain Layer | Secondary Glaze / Accent | Visual Aesthetic Result |
|---|---|---|---|
| Rich American Walnut | Medium Walnut Gel Stain | Dark Espresso Gel Stain in crevices | Deep chocolate tone with prominent dark grain lines |
| Classic Golden Oak | Colonial / Golden Oak Stain | Light Walnut dry-brushed lightly | Warm honey-amber with natural golden undertones |
| Antique Mahogany | Cherry or Red Chestnut Gel | Mahogany / Burnt Umber accent | Lustrous reddish-brown with dramatic fiery depth |
| Weathered Driftwood Gray | Warm Gray or Greige Gel Stain | Charcoal Gray feathered in grain | Modern coastal rustic finish with subtle contrast |
| Dark Mission Craftsman | Dark Oak Gel Stain | Ebony Gel Stain wiped along stiles | Bold, dramatic dark finish suitable for artisan homes |
Layering two contrasting stain tones produces rich organic depth that mimics natural tree growth rings and vascular grain.
Environmental Factors, Drying Times, and Clear Coat Durability
Environmental conditions during the staining process heavily influence the final finish. Oil-based gel stains contain mineral spirit solvents that require moderate temperatures and low humidity to cure properly. The ideal application window is between 60°F and 80°F (16°C to 27°C) with relative humidity below 65 percent. Staining under direct sun or on high-humidity rainy days causes the gel stain to skin over prematurely, trapping un-evaporated solvents underneath, which leads to bubbling, wrinkling, and weeks of tacky, un-cured paint film.
The ultimate durability of the door rests on the protective clear coat. Gel stain provides color but possesses minimal resistance to physical abrasion and zero resistance to solar ultraviolet (UV) radiation. Unprotected gel stain exposed to southern or western sun exposure will fade, chalk, and powder away within two seasons. Applying three coats of marine-grade exterior spar varnish or waterborne poly-acrylic formulated with hindered amine light stabilizers (HALS) provides a flexible, waterproof shield that flexes with seasonal temperature swings.
The table below outlines clear topcoat options, UV protection capabilities, and maintenance schedules for stained fiberglass doors.
| Topcoat Finish Type | Sheen Level | UV Resistance Rating | Maintenance Recoat Cycle |
|---|---|---|---|
| Marine Spar Varnish (Oil) | Gloss or Satin | Maximum UV protection (Tung oil / phenolic) | Inspect and recoat every 2 to 3 years |
| Exterior Waterborne Acrylic | Satin or Matte | High UV resistance; non-yellowing clear | Inspect and recoat every 3 to 4 years |
| Standard Interior Polyurethane | Gloss / Semi-gloss | Zero UV inhibitors (Will crack and peel) | Unacceptable for exterior door applications |
| Exterior Urethane with HALS | Satin | Superior resistance to solar chalking | Recoat every 3 to 5 years depending on exposure |
| Lacquer Clear Finish | High Gloss | Brittle; poor exterior thermal flexibility | Unacceptable for outdoor fiberglass doors |
Waterborne exterior clear coats are non-yellowing, making them ideal for preserving light golden oak or modern gray driftwood door stains.
How to Achieve a Wood-Look on a Fiberglass Door in 4 Steps
Follow this step-by-step artisan protocol to stain and seal an exterior fiberglass entry door.
Wipe Down with Degreaser and Mineral Spirits
Clean the factory-primed or textured fiberglass surface using mineral spirits to remove manufacturing release agents, tape residue, and skin oils.
Work Gel Stain Systematically by Section
Apply oil-based gel stain with a lint-free cloth or foam brush, completing interior recessed panels first, horizontal rails second, and outer vertical stiles last.
Feather with Natural China Bristles
Lightly drag a dry natural bristle brush along the wet grain lines with long, continuous strokes, wiping excess pigment on a shop towel to build natural contrast.
Apply Three Protective Exterior Topcoats
After curing for 48 hours, brush on three coats of exterior spar urethane containing UV inhibitors, sanding lightly with 320-grit paper between cured coats.
Frequently Asked Questions (8 Questions Answered)
Q1: What is the best stain brand for fiberglass doors?
Minwax Gel Stain, General Finishes Gel Stain, and Old Masters Gel Stain are the most widely recommended brands for fiberglass doors due to their rich pigment concentration.
Q2: Can you use a gel stain over an already stained fiberglass door?
Yes, if the existing finish is sound, clean with mineral spirits, scuff lightly with 320-grit sandpaper, and apply a fresh coat of gel stain to darken or refresh the color.
Q3: Why does gel stain look streaky when first applied?
Gel stain looks uneven when first smeared on; the key to a flawless look is the subsequent dry-brushing step, which evenly distributes pigments along the grain channels.
Q4: How do you clean brushes after using oil-based gel stain?
Clean natural bristle brushes thoroughly by swirling them in mineral spirits or paint thinner, followed by washing with warm water and liquid dish soap.
Q5: What happens if it rains while the gel stain is drying?
Moisture will cause water spotting, cloudiness, or premature lifting of the stain; always check the weather forecast to ensure 48 hours of dry weather or stain the door indoors.
Q6: Can you stain the edges and weatherstripping of a fiberglass door?
Stain the top, bottom, and side latch edges of the door slab, but avoid staining rubber or vinyl weatherstripping and door sweeps, as solvents will degrade flexible rubber.
Q7: How do you fix a spot where the stain went on too dark?
While the stain is wet, dampen a clean cloth lightly with mineral spirits and wipe the area gently to lift excess pigment, then re-blend with your dry brush.
Q8: How often should you re-seal a stained fiberglass door?
Inspect the clear topcoat annually; doors facing direct southern or western sun typically benefit from a fresh maintenance coat of exterior spar urethane every two to three years.
